          @dannytaurus @David-Healey Can't the CC mapping simply be removed from the preset using the handler? Isn't the custom preset intended for this purpose in the first place? Never tried myself that being said...

          Just checked and the answer is no, you can't manage what is written... But Claude came with a neat solution:

          // (processBeforeLoading, unpackComplexData)
          uph.setEnableUserPresetPreprocessing(true, false);
          
          uph.setPreCallback(function(presetData)
          {
              // presetData is a JS object; MidiAutomation is a top-level property.
              // Emptying it means applyJSON rebuilds an empty <MidiAutomation> node,
              // so the incoming preset never overwrites the current CC assignments.
              presetData.MidiAutomation = {}; // or just rewrite what you already saved
          });

            @David-Healey @David-Healey So the working solution is

            const var currentAutomationState = {"ChildId": "Controller", "Children": []};
            
            const var mah = Engine.createMidiAutomationHandler();
            
            mah.setUpdateCallback(function()
            {
            	currentAutomationState.Children = this.getAutomationDataObject();
            });
            
            
            
            const var uph = Engine.createUserPresetHandler();
            
            uph.setEnableUserPresetPreprocessing(true, false);
            
            uph.setPreCallback(function(presetData)
            {
                presetData.MidiAutomation = currentAutomationState;
            });
            

            The automation state is saved in the instance but you can just save it in a file if you wish so.
            I'd prefer not in my case, because if you load multiple instances of the plugin, they'll all react to the same CC...

                @David-Healey Apparently macro yes, but MPE 🤷♂
                Here's the automation data object:

                [
                  {
                    "Controller": 6,
                    "Channel": -1,
                    "Processor": "Interface",
                    "MacroIndex": -1,
                    "Start": 0.0,
                    "End": 1.0,
                    "FullStart": 0.0,
                    "FullEnd": 1.0,
                    "Skew": 3.106283926937945,
                    "Interval": 0.0,
                    "Converter": "37.nT6K8CBGgC..VEFa0U1Pu4lckIGckIG.ADPXiQWZ1UF.ADf...",
                    "Attribute": "HiBoostBWKnb",
                    "Inverted": false
                  }
                ]

                                @ustk said in Saving MIDI CC assignments in user presets?:

                                So the working solution is

                                I think there's more to it, at least if you're saving/loading it from a file.

                                setUpdateCallback is triggered before on init and setPreCallback is only triggered when loading a preset.

                                So we need it to be that when we make a change to automation we save the the object to a file.
                                Then at init we load that object from the file using setAutomationDataFromObject
                                And during preload we pass the object into preset data.
